About the role:

The primary function of this role is to deliver dedicated Best-in-Class Service to selected key accounts. A key focus is to work proactively to achieve operational excellence to create and maintain an outstanding experience for our customers.

What you’ll do:

You will be responsible for the accurate processing, planning, and delivery of orders for the major and national accounts within the portfolio, not only from the UK but direct from the Supply Units. You will be expected to take ownership of the operational service duties and be required to develop and maintain key relationships with both internal and external customers, ensuring that customer requirements and expectations are resolved quickly and efficiently as delivery performance is paramount.

In detail, you will:
  • Address customer queries regarding stock, delivery, price, and product specifications via email and telephone.
  • Serve as the primary contact for selected accounts.
  • Process orders accurately and manage local systems, including SAP and relevant transportation systems.
  • Plan loads and optimize vehicle utilization from UK RDCs and Supply Units.
  • Adhere to SLAs and KPIs, focusing on maintaining and improving processes.
  • Manage stock bookings into customer warehouses and liaise with our Distribution Centres.
  • Monitor delivery performance metrics and proactively work on improvements to add value and enhance the customer experience.
  • Ensure accurate alignment of delivery notes, PODs, and invoices.
  • Maintain close communication with both internal and external customers.
  • Actively participate in collaboration and customer meetings.
  • Handle inbound/outbound traffic (fax, email, post, telephone) for pre-sales environments.
  • Make decisions and take actions regarding customer queries, requests, and complaints within business and departmental practices.
  • Maintain a continuous and high-level focus on customer service.
